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ion Criteria

  • Inclusion – eligible participants must meet all of the following criteria:
  • \-Held their full car license (class C) for a minimum of two years
  • \-Drive at least 3 hours per week
  • \-Bedtime 2200 ±2hrs; waketime 0800 ±2hrs; between 6\-11 hours in bed
  • \-Reading/Speaking English fluency
  • \-Able to give informed, written consent
  • \-Age/gender matched (i.e., aim to recruit equal numbers of male/female participants whose ages match to ensure a representative sample of individuals in this age group (20\-35 years old)
  • Comprehensive/Questionnaires
  • \-Insomnia Severity Index (ISI) \<10
  • \-Epworth Sleepiness Score (ESS) \<10

Exclusion Criteria

  • Exclusion – eligible participants will not exhibit any of the following:
  • \-Active Health/mental health/sleep conditions that alter sleep; or BMI \>35
  • \-History of TBI, stroke, or neurodegenerative disorder (Parkinson’s disease, Dementia)
  • \-Active use of OTC or prescription medications that alter sleep (previous 2 months)
  • \-Active illicit substance use (previous 2 months)
  • \-Elevated alcohol and caffeine use (\>4 x alcohol and/or caffeine drinks per day; OR \>10 alcoholic drinks per week)
  • \-Smoking dependence (non\-casual smoking)
  • \-Pregnancy, lactating, or caring for a newborn (12 months and under)
  • \-Recent overnight shift workers (working 2300\-0600 at least once per week in previous 2 months); recent time\-zone travel encompassing \>2 zones (previous 2 months)
